Everyone starts in Bronze 1. You only play players in Bronze 1. If you win the Super Bowl in Bronze 1 you move to Bronze 2 and can never go back to Bronze 1. Now you only play players in Bronze 2. Rinse and repeat. The better division you are in the better rewards, similar to now. I lost interest in MUT this year because I just wanted to play casually and I was getting matched up with demons.

Cliffs

  • Make 24+ ranks

  • Only play people in your rank

  • Only move up rank by winning the SB

  • Can never go back to a lower rank
